If you're comparing an off-the-plan property agent in Melbourne, the first thing to establish is who they actually work for. Most Melbourne "off-the-plan agents" are project-marketing agents engaged and paid by a single developer to sell that developer's stock — their advice is naturally weighted toward it.


BK Home Broker works differently: an independent, zero-fee broker with live access to house-and-land, townhouse, and apartment stock across Melbourne's growth corridors and inner suburbs, paid by the builder or developer at settlement — never by you.



What Does an Off-the-Plan Property Agent in Melbourne Actually Do?

A genuine agent or broker compares multiple builders and projects against your budget, timeline, and purpose, checks contract terms and building permits, and negotiates on your behalf, rather than steering you toward the one project they're contracted to sell. Ask any Melbourne off-the-plan agent directly: how many builders or developers do you represent, and who pays your fee?

Zero-Fee Broker vs. Traditional Selling Agent

A project-marketing agent is contracted by one developer and paid to sell that developer's stock — they generally can't show you a competing project down the road, even if it's better value. BK Home Broker isn't attached to a single project, comparing options across builders and growth corridors at a purchase price identical to buying direct.
